Abstract

An apparatus for detecting images in a first selected bandwidth includes a probe light source to generate a probe beam in a second selected bandwidth, an optical path including input imaging optics to capture an image in the first selected bandwidth and form an image beam and a beam combiner to optically combine the probe beam with the image beam to form a combined beam, and an optical readout quantum well device in the optical path of the combined beam, which simultaneously passes in an optical readout beam an intensity level of at least one wavelength within the probe beam in the second selected bandwidth in proportion to an intensity level of at least one wavelength within the image beam in the first selected bandwidth; and a detector sensitive to light in the second selected bandwidth and not sensitive to light in the first selected bandwidth.
